IT Manager - Remote - US Citizenship

Oracle is a world leader in cloud solutions, and they are seeking an IT Manager to lead a team focused on product development and strategy for Oracle Health. The role involves managing multiple client environments, ensuring performance and security of hosted technology platforms, and driving operational targets and process improvements.

Responsibilities

Manage a team of System & Site Reliability Engineers supporting the performance, security, and overall domain operation of hosted technology platforms
Lead and direct the team’s strategy to achieve operational or functional targets, SLAs, and objectives with measurable contribution towards the achievement of immediate and short-term results for the team and Federal Client Operations organization
Engage and lead in all phases of Incident, Problem and Change Management
Establish and communicate organization and team goals that support and advance team and organization objectives; establish metrics or other performance measures to track progress, accomplishments, and opportunities
Understand and explain policies, best practices, and organizational procedures within immediate area of responsibility to key stakeholders within and outside of the team
Identify, propose, and lead process improvement initiatives; participate and provide input on strategic initiatives at the organization and team level
Deliver consistent and timely training, guidance, and feedback to encourage and promote employee success and growth through regular developmental conversations and identification of developmental opportunities

Benefits

Medical, dental, and vision insurance, including expert medical opinion
Short term disability and long term disability
Life insurance and AD&D
Supplemental life insurance (Employee/Spouse/Child)
Health care and dependent care Flexible Spending Accounts
Pre-tax commuter and parking benefits
401(k) Savings and Investment Plan with company match
Paid time off: Flexible Vacation is provided to all eligible employees assigned to a salaried (non-overtime eligible) position. Accrued Vacation is provided to all other employees eligible for vacation benefits. For employees working at least 35 hours per week, the vacation accrual rate is 13 days annually for the first three years of employment and 18 days annually for subsequent years of employment. Vacation accrual is prorated for employees working between 20 and 34 hours per week. Employees working fewer than 20 hours per week are not eligible for vacation.
11 paid holidays
Paid sick leave: 72 hours of paid sick leave upon date of hire. Refreshes each calendar year. Unused balance will carry over each year up to a maximum cap of 112 hours.
Paid parental leave
Adoption assistance
Employee Stock Purchase Plan
Financial planning and group legal
Voluntary benefits including auto, homeowner and pet insurance
